When measuring an object, you need to use a ruler. A ruler, however, has two different types of measurement scales for length: standard and metric. Day-to-day, at least in the United States, you use the standard system of measurement, which is inches.
If you guessed that 12 inches are in a foot, you are right! However, in the experiment today, you will be using both the standard system AND the metric system of measurement. The metric system of measurement uses centimeters instead of inches. If you have a ruler with you (be sure to grab one now if you do not have one), you will see that centimeters are smaller than inches. This is because about 2-½ centimeters equal 1 inch. When doing a scientific discovery, you should always use centimeters. But in this lesson, you will be able to use inches and centimeters to see how they compare with one another.
